    Ten people have been arrested and are facing over 70 drug charges in Southland and Otago


    Police seized 16 thousand dollars, ammunition, drugs, and other drug paraphernalia uncovered in a series of search warrants targeting drug dealers with gang connections.

    The 10 people face charges, from supplying methamphetamine, MDMA, cocaine, LSD and cannabis, to possession of restricted weapons and ammunition.

    Detective Senior Sergeant Greg Baird say investigations are ongoing and they expect to make more arrests in coming days.
